Philippe-Emmanuel Sorlin and André S. Labarthe draw up an overview of Japanese cinematographers met in Tokyo. This documentary is revealing a dynamic Nippon period in the late 20th Century: a striking cinematographic era of numerous filmmakers with a true aesthetic politic of filmmaking, initiating the comparison with 60's French Nouvelle Vague. A new Nouvelle Vague was born in the Japanese 90's.
